Penyffordd Lions win the Presidents Cup.

Nicky Williams' latest hat-trick pushed him up to 54 goals for the season as Plas Madoc extended their lead at the top of the table to six points with a 3-1 win at Mold Town United n Thursday night.
The home side replied with a Darrell Rees penalty.
Airbus UK Broughton racked up an 11-1 triumph at Halkyn United, Liam Schofield netting six, Jack Samuel three, Jack Murphy and Josh Wright one apiece, Josh Richardson with a consolation for the hosts.
Penyffordd won the Presidents Cup on Tuesday night after beating league leaders Plas Madoc on penalties at The Rock.
Adam Pugh netted from the spot for Penyffordd in the match itself, which ended 1-1 after extra time, Josh Williams on the mark for Madoc.
Grant Tattum's double earned Caerwys a 2-1 result at Mostyn Dragons, while a Ben Tudor own goal was enough for Rhosllanerchrugog to see off Mold Town United 1-0.
Flint Mountain were 3-1 winners at Connah's Quay Nomads Under-18s.
